sota-mcp
MCP server for Summits on the Air (SOTA) β live spots, activation alerts, summit info, and nearby summits through any MCP-compatible AI assistant.
Part of the QSO-Graph project. No authentication required β uses the public SOTA API exclusively.
Install
pip install sota-mcp
Tools
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
sota_spots | Current and recent spots with time window and association/mode filters |
sota_alerts | Upcoming scheduled activation alerts |
sota_summit_info | Summit details by SOTA reference code |
sota_summits_near | Find summits near coordinates (geospatial search) |
Quick Start
No credentials needed β just install and configure your MCP client.
Configure your MCP client
sota-mcp works with any MCP-compatible client. Add the server config and restart β tools appear automatically.
Claude Desktop
Add to claude_desktop_config.json (~/Library/Application Support/Claude/ on macOS, %APPDATA%\Claude\ on Windows):
{
"mcpServers": {
"sota": {
"command": "sota-mcp"
}
}
}
Claude Code
Add to .claude/settings.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"sota": {
"command": "sota-mcp"
}
}
}

Testing Without Network
For testing all tools without hitting the SOTA APIs:
SOTA_MCP_MOCK=1 sota-mcp
MCP Inspector
sota-mcp --transport streamable-http --port 8007
Then open the MCP Inspector at http://localhost:8007.
